Final expense insurance offers peace of mind by helping families escape difficulties after a close person's demise. This a type of life insurance specifically designed to reimburse burial expenses, celebrations of life, and associated debts. Generally, these plans provide modest payouts relative to larger life insurance policies, and commonly demand smaller policy contributions be eligible. Understanding the details of a final expense coverage is crucial to ensuring informed decisions concerning your estate planning safeguarding your loved ones’ security.

End-of-Life Insurance: Securing Your Heirs' Future
Unexpected events can leave a heavy financial burden on your relatives . Funeral expense insurance offers comfort by enabling to cover end-of-life arrangements, outstanding bills, and other associated expenses . This kind of coverage is designed to be affordable and straightforward to obtain , providing a important financial cushion for your beneficiaries when they need it most, eliminating a difficult economic strain at an sensitive time.
